Opening April 15th 2025!Grand Wailea, A Waldorf Astoria Resort, is thrilled to announce a culinary partnership with the globally-celebrated restaurant group, Nobu.Designed by the renowned architecture and design firm Rockwell Group, Nobu will offer over 13,000 square feet of indoor and alfresco dining spaces, complimented by striking murals and panoramic ocean views.The restaurant will spotlight Nobu signature dishes such as the iconic Black Cod Miso and Yellowtail Jalapeño, alongside the acclaimed sushi synonymous with the brand.

Discover KOMO, Four Season Resort Maui's vibrant new sushi destination. Led by master chef Kiyokuni "Kiyo" Ikeda, KOMO promises a refined yet relaxed dining experience where authentic Japanese cuisine meets the breathtaking beauty of Hawaii. Bringing his expertise from Japan and over two decades of masterful technique, Chef Kiyo creates extraordinary presentations that are meant to be shared and celebrated. KOMO welcomes you with the warmth of Hawaiian hospitality and the precision of Japanese cuisine.Diners can choose to enjoy their meal by reserving seats either at the sushi bar, for an immersive experience, or in the intimate dining room.
